Boat Charters
Mermaid Diving strives to accommodate your needs. If
you wish to charter our boat, or would like a group booking, we can
help to organise your dive trip and make it a diving holiday to remember!
For those wanting to dive solo we can find you a buddy for your dive.
Our extensive knowledge of dive sites in the area stems from our dedicated
instructors and the knowledge from our Mermaid Pleasure Trips
skipper. We have a large portfolio of sites that cover all levels of
diving. Feel free to call us to discuss your needs and to find out about
group discounts. Safety is paramount to us. You will receive detailed
boat and safety briefings which we expect everyone to adhere to. We
also give full Dive Site briefings including depth, features and points
of interest. We also provide surface support crew, who among other things,
will record your air and dive time and also adds that additional level
of safety.
Please note that current log books and certification cards are required
from you and every member of your party. We will not allow anybody to
dive without these documents.
Guided Dives
We offer guided dives of local dive sites. You will be guided by one of our knowledgeable guides and accompanied by a safety diver. These are excellent for the first dives of the season or if you haven't been in the water for a little while. They are also ideal if you're new to diving, have little experience with shore or boat diving in UK waters, looking to build up your confidence or just fancy being shown around by an experienced guide. A guided dive will enhance your diving experience and can take the stress out of trying to find your way around a dive site. Your guide is well acquainted with the dive sites and can show you the hiding places of amazing underwater creatures, canon's and other hidden treasures! We do these dives from our boat or from a local shore diving site, which is widely claimed to be the best shore dive in the country!
Try Dives
Try dives are an excellent introduction to the world of SCUBA. We hold these in the comfort and safety of a local indoor pool, with a specialised dive pit. Try dives are run by one of our experienced and patient PADI qualified Instructors or Dive Masters. They are a good way to find out if diving is right for you, for children, or to encourage non-diving friends and family members to become your new dive buddy! These trips also make brilliant unusual gifts - we even do gift vouchers! Try dives are great value for money at only £20 per person including equipment. Try dives are available for ages 8 upwards.
Scuba reviews
We recommend that you undertake a SCUBA Review if you have not dived for an extensive period of time. These courses are held in the comfort and safety of a dedicated dive pit at a local indoor pool. This course refreshes the skills you learnt in you Open Water course and is an excellent way to get back your confidence. The SCUBA review aims to get you back on top form and ready for a shore or boat dive.
